Did You Know?

It’s never too late - or too early -  to begin an active lifestyle.  The health benefits of regular physical activity are well documented.  Research has shown that physical activity can help you - control weight,  control high blood pressure, reduce risk for type 2 diabetes, and more. WE CAN! GO, SLOW, WHOA WIDGET ADDED

The We Can! program has a new widget that offers drop-down menus to allow you to select a food group, such as breads and cereals, and discover which foods in that group are the healthiest to eat. There are an estimated ten million obese and overweight American kids who experience the ongoing frustrations associated with excessive weight and often do not know where to turn.  The Center Helping Obesity in Children End Successfully, Inc., a grassroots organization formed in April 2002 to join the fight against the deadly epidemic of childhood obesity.  CHOICES aims to spread awareness of this critical issue and significantly reduce the presence of childhood obesity in our communities.  CHOICES has created programs serving Kennesaw and metro Atlanta GA that focus on fitness activities and healthy weight control for children.
